6 Rivington Close, Tarleton, Preston, PR4 6DS is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 947 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£251,082 , which equates to approximately £265 per square foot. It was last sold on 28 Apr 2022 for £210,000. Since then, the value has increased by £41,082, representing a 19.6% increase, or approximately 5.4% per year.

6 Rivington Close, Tarleton, Preston, West Lancashire, Lancashire, PR4 6DS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 6 Dec 2019.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 11 Dec 2009.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 1.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 75 mm loft insulation to flat, limited ins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to average.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 20%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from poor to very poor.
